"What is my secret? You have to win games one at a time," the Frenchman said in an interview with France Football magazine.
"Hard work without talent is not enough though.
"My lucky star has always been there, shining above my head, even when things do not go so well.
"That is why I always keep positive, although normally I have an appearance of seriousness."
The Real Madrid and France legend also explained his approach to managing the personalities of the various superstars in the locker room of the 'Blancos'.
"What I am trying to transmit is that everybody is important," Zidane said.
"The players perform well because they are committed in the context of a great collective energy and they compliment each other very well in the dressing room."
